The cinematic adaptations of “Buratino” and “Prostokvashino” have officially crossed the 2 billion ruble threshold in box office receipts. This achievement is confirmed by the latest data from the EAIS tracking system.
Igor Voloshin’s “Buratino” has secured 2.070 billion rubles to date, while Sarik Andreasyan’s “Prostokvashino” reached 2.092 billion rubles. Both features premiered across domestic cinemas on January 1st.
This follows the record-breaking performance of “Cheburashka 2,” which has already amassed over 4 billion rubles.
